GUSTO ITALIAN logo.
  • Browse menu
  • Restaurant info

GUSTO ITALIAN

Address

8 Church St, Lutterworth LE17 4AW

Got questions?

7466874649
OrderYOYO © 2026
Privacy policyTerms of useAbout cookies